When pressure cleaning your home, it is necessary to do it appropriately to get the finest outcomes. You'll want to select a high quality stress washing machine that fits your requirements.



When it comes time to clean, start from the leading and also work your method down, so the dust and particles don't kick back onto your house. Be sure to preserve your pressure washer by cleansing out the hose pipes as well as nozzles after each usage. Following these ideas will help make sure an effective pressure-washing job as well as keep your residence looking terrific.

There are a couple of various sorts of pressure washing machines readily available, each with different power levels, so you must select one that is suitable for your job. For smaller sized tasks, like cleansing siding and pathways, a lighter-duty design with 2000 to 3000 PSI (extra pounds per square inch) ought to suffice. For larger tasks, like eliminating paint from block or concrete, a heavier-duty model with over 3000 PSI is recommended.

When preparing your residence for stress washing, ensure to cover any kind of exterior furniture, plants, and also other products that could be impacted by the pressure washing machine. Eliminate any type of things that can not be covered and get rid of particles from the outside walls and surface areas. Get rid of any type of loose things, such as home window screens and also shutters.

Make certain to use security goggles and also gloves to safeguard on your own from the pressure washer. Move the pressure washing machine nozzle regularly from the house and job in tiny areas.

We have actually all seen that dark hideous growth on siding, especially after a damp loss and also winter months - siding cleaning. The mold and mildew or mildew, moss, or algae may be unavoidable, but cleansing it off your home is vital before it spreads out as well as completely discolorations and damages your residence's exterior. If you have a power washer, a device that sprays pressurized water, cleaning up the sides of the home may sound like a reasonable do it yourself project.

That includes the exterior on the 2nd floor, the smokeshaft, as well as all the crevices. Mold and mildew may be worse on one side of your house than the various other, yet the dust and crud go anywhere. Additionally, dealing with that high water pressure can be a little bit difficult: it's possible to harm your house dent siding, tear down bricks, hole screens if you use also much pressure or aim incorrect.
